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77 385 97234 50909
7079362 6821 239636
7079362 6821 239636
87682 650093216 64302
All about undefined
Interested in learning more?
7079362 6821 239636
87682 650093216 64302
See more
687664283 80
0563963 499 94 3452957 3529
See more
6611441434 4961 718706076
532 45112 5811651
See more